The sleek hockey puck, designed by Yves Behar, combines the functions of a traditional cable box with media streaming boxes like Apple TV and Roku. Today, Fan TV has finally reached an agreement with a national cable company — and as a result, its set-top box will soon be available in some of the countrys biggest markets. Time Warner Cable, which serves 30 million customers across the country, said today that it will be compatible with Fan TV when the device ships at the end of this quarter. The Fan TV experience is a leap forward for the cable industry, said Mike Angus, a senior vice president at Time Warner, in a statement.
